import farsight
class JingleTransportICEUDP(JingleTransport):
def __init__(self):
JingleTransport.__init__(self, TransportType.datagram)
def make_candidate(self, candidate):
types = {farsight.CANDIDATE_TYPE_HOST: 'host',
farsight.CANDIDATE_TYPE_SRFLX: 'srflx',
farsight.CANDIDATE_TYPE_PRFLX: 'prflx',
farsight.CANDIDATE_TYPE_RELAY: 'relay',
farsight.CANDIDATE_TYPE_MULTICAST: 'multicast'}
attrs = {
'component': candidate.component_id,
'foundation': '1', # hack
'generation': '0',
'ip': candidate.ip,
'network': '0',
'port': candidate.port,
'priority': int(candidate.priority), # hack
}
if candidate.type in types:
attrs['type'] = types[candidate.type]
if candidate.proto == farsight.NETWORK_PROTOCOL_UDP:
attrs['protocol'] = 'udp'
else:
# we actually don't handle properly different tcp options in jingle
attrs['protocol'] = 'tcp'
return xmpp.Node('candidate', attrs=attrs)
def make_transport(self, candidates=None):
transport = JingleTransport.make_transport(self, candidates)
transport.setNamespace(xmpp.NS_JINGLE_ICE_UDP)
if self.candidates and self.candidates[0].username and \
self.candidates[0].password:
transport.setAttr('ufrag', self.candidates[0].username)
transport.setAttr('pwd', self.candidates[0].password)
return transport
